PREFACE


We herewith present Vol. XIV of the Charlotte City Directory. No more striking evidence of the growth of the City of Charlotte can be had than by reference to this book.


The directory is more than a mere list of residents with their occupation and addresses; it is a complete and accurate guide to your city, your government, your institutions and other organiza- tions. It is a history of your City.


There is no publication in. the world which gives the informa- tion contained in the city directory, therefore there is probably no other publication in which all the people are so vitally interested. To gather the data and compile a volume of this character is no easy task. It requires time, system, patience and experience, and incurs no little expense. Very few people have any idea of the work it means and the tenacity it takes to get out a complete di- rectory.


The directory, therefore, is a publication which stands in a class to itself, and is one of the foremost enterprises of any city, for it is a salesman that is always "on the job." Therefore, it should re- ceive your liberal support, for without such it cannot exist.


This volume contains 18,502 names of individuals. Using the conservative multiple 21/2 times to represent the names of the wo- men and children not included or counted, indicates a population of


46,255


In concluding we desire to thank our patrons for their support. We shall endeavor to deliver our next issue of the Charlotte Di- rectory not later than May 15th, which is the proper time. Yours truly


PIEDMONT DIRECTORY CO, E. H. MILLER, Pres.

Miscellaneous Department CHARLOTTE DIRECTORY


CITY, COUNTY, STATE AND UNITED STATES GOVERNMENT, AND MUCH OTHER USEFUL INFORMATION


Note-This department is not a regular part of the Directory, the data in most cases being furnished to us, therefore we do not claim that it is com- plete ; we will, however, gladly insert any useful information furnished us in time-Publrs


MISCELLANEOUS 17


CITY GOVERNMENT


(Executive Department)


Office, City Hall, n Tryon, s e cor 5th Mayor-Dr Chas A Bland Mayor Pro Tem-Col W W Phifer City Clerk & Treas-A H Wearn City Tax Collector-J M Wilson City Attorney-Chase Brenizer Chief of Police-T M Christenbury City Recorder-W B Smith


City Physician-F O Hawley


City Engineer-Joseph Firth Chief Fire Dept-J H Wallace


City Plumb'g Inspector-Edw Hyland


City Cotton Weigher-J S Withers City Electrician-R P Connelly Inspector of Plumbing-E Hyland Sanitary Inspector-C S Roberts Superintendent of Schools-A Graham Supt of Water Works-W E Vest Superintendent of Streets-D T Ritch Keeper of Elmwood Cemetery- C M Berryhill


Keeper Pinewood Cemetery-A Phifer Superintendent of Crematory - J W Stewart


Janitor City Hall-N P Ross


Aldermen


Aldermen-Ward 1 W F Stevens, J P Carr, R F Stokes and W R Matthews; Ward 2 J W Lewis, C M Strong and W A Watson; Ward 3 A M Guillet, J F Wilkes and R J Sifford; Ward 4 J C Hunter, W W Phifer and T M Webb; Ward 5 Lewis Anderson; Ward 6 J A Austin, Ward 7 E L Mason: Ward 8 J L Sexton, and E W Thompson; Ward 9 J C Montgomery; Ward 10 D L Kistler; Ward 11 L \/ Wingate

COUNTY GOVERNMENT


(Mecklenburg County)


Charlotte County Seat-Court House, South Tryon, s e cor 3d


Superior Court-J L Webb judge Clerk-C C Moore Deputy-P V Moody


Clerk invested with full probate power Sheriff-N W Wallace


Deputy-S W Porter


Tax Collector District No 1-Wm C McAuley (Huntersville) District No 2 N W Wallace (Charlotte) District No 3 J W Hood (Matthews)


Register of Deeds-W M Moore


Deputy-R L Sing


Treasurer-J W Stinson


Suveyor-J B Spratt


Supt Education-Wm Anderson Coroner-Z A Hovis Physician-Dr C S Mclaughlin


Attorney-Burwell & Cansler


Keeper County Home-T J Holton Janitor Ct Hse-S W Kirkpatrick Jailor-E O Johnson


County Commissioners - W M Long Chairman; Wm N McKee, D A Hender- son, F F Beatty and W J Dunn


County Finance Committee - W S Pharr, Thos Griffith, J P Pharr County Board of Education PD Price, Steele Creek; C H Caldwell, Char- lotte; B D Funderburk, Matthews; A F Long, Huntersville


Court Calendar


Superior Court, 12th Judicial Circuit- J L Webb, resident judge; C C Moore clerk


Convenes: 3d Monday before the 1st Monday in March, 3d Monday before the 1st in Sept, each of said terms to continue for two (2) weeks also on the 7th Mon- day after the 1st Monday in March on the 13th Monday after the 1st Monday in March on the 3d Monday after the 1st Monday in Sept and on 13th Monday after the 1st Monday in Sept each of


said terms to continue for one week for trial of criminal cases exclusively


On the 7th Monday before the 1st Monday in March on the 1st Monday after the 1st Monday in March on the 7th Monday before the 1st Monday in Sept each of said terms to continue for two (2) weeks, also on the 8th Monday after the 1st Monday in March on the 14th Monday after the 1st Monday in March on the 12th Monday after the 1st Monday in Sept each of said terms to continue for one week also on the 4th Monday after the 1st Monday in Sept said term to continue for three (3) weeks for the trial of civil cases exclusively


STATE GOVERNMENT OF NORTH CAROLINA


Governor-W W Kitchin


Lieutenant-Governor-W C Newland Private Sec to Governor-A J Field Secretary of State-J Bryan Grimes State Treasurer-Benjamin R Lacy State Auditor-Benjamin F Dixon Attorney-General-T W Bickett Superintendent of Public Instruction-


J Y Joyner


Adjutant-General-T R Robertson State Librarian-M O Sherrill Superintendent of Public Buildings-C C Sherry


State Standard Keeper-L H Lumsden Commissioner of Labor and Printing -- M L Shipman


Insurance Commissioner - James R Young


State Printer-E M Uzzell


Governor's Council


The Secretary of State, Treasurer, Auditor and Superintendent of Public In- struction


State Board of Education


The Governor, Lieutenant-Governor, Secretary of State, Treasurer, Auditor, Superintendent of Public Instruction and Attorney-General


State Board of Public Buildings and Grounds


The Governor, Secretary of State Treasurer and Attorney-General


State Board of Pensions


The Governor, Auditor, Treasurer and Attorney-General


Judiciary


Supreme Court-Chief Justice Walter Clark


Associate Justices-P D Walker, H G Connor, Geo H Brown Jr, and Wm A Hoke
